Why The Carlyle Group Stock Tanked by Nearly 14% Today

Thursday wasn't an especially inspiring day for the stock market, but it was an exceptional downer for investors of The Carlyle Group (NASDAQ: CG). Shares of the storied financial services company dove by almost 14%, a far worse performance than the 0.7% dip of the S&P 500 index. Carlyle released its first-quarter figures before the trading session opened Thursday, revealing that it earned revenue of $859 million.
